Overview

Peter Cummings is the co-chair of Bodman’s Intellectual Property Practice Group. He has over a decade of experience protecting new technologies and products in global markets. He is passionate about helping clients merge patent and intellectual property strategies with business objectives in evolving competitive landscapes. 

His practice focuses on providing strategic counsel and guidance on domestic and foreign patent procurement strategies and patent and trademark portfolio management. He prepares and prosecutes patent applications in a wide range of mechanical and electromechanical technologies. He also advises clients on patentability and freedom-to-operate issues and on transactional matters involving the development, use, and ownership of intellectual property assets. 

Peter serves a variety of clients ranging from multinational manufacturers and technology-driven companies to start-ups and entrepreneurs. He has particular experience advising Tier-1 automotive suppliers, having spent time seconded in-house with a global supplier to assist with developing and implementing a comprehensive IP strategy, handling technology-focused transactional matters, and learning real-world issues of the industry.

He also has clients in the consumer electronics, medical device, concrete formwork, and general manufacturing industries. His diverse skill set and experiences in both the procurement and transactional fields allow him to see the bigger picture and, as a result, better serve the client’s goals and expectations.

His services to clients include: 

  • Managing and developing patent portfolios in the U.S. and worldwide
  • Preparing and prosecuting utility and design patent applications to optimize protection coverage, while balancing timing and cost constraints
  • Evaluating patent landscapes to identify protection opportunities, competitors, and potential infringers 
  • Rendering legal opinions on patent validity and non-infringement
  • Assisting with trade secret protection measures and providing clients with internal seminars.
  • Advising on freedom-to-operate issues for new products and services, including collaborative design-around counseling 
  • Conducting due diligence reviews of intellectual property portfolios for M&A transactions
  • Drafting and counseling on joint development agreements, licensing agreements, and various other forms of commercial and technology agreements that involve intellectual property 

Peter is admitted to practice before the U.S. District Court for the Western District of Michigan. At Michigan State University College of Law, he served as Managing Editor of the International Law Review and was Vice President of the Intellectual Property Law Society.

Representative Matters
Representative Matters:
  • Advises multiple international Tier-1 suppliers on patent and trademark portfolio development and management matters, including obtaining several patents in key product technologies to strategically expand their patent portfolios 
  • Secondment at a Tier-1 automotive supplier to advise on the development and implementation of an intellectual property policy and invention disclosure system, and also to assist with technology transactions and internal training on related intellectual property issues
  • Drafted and prosecuted hundreds of patent applications and manages filing, prosecution, and maintenance of international patent families
  • Represented a venture-backed, medical device company through a complex patent clearance on a miniaturized surgical robot for abdominal surgical procedures
  • Assisted in defending several oppositions to related European patents that were part of a multi-venue patent enforcement dispute
  • Obtained a patent portfolio for a start-up company that was successfully enforced and later acquired
  • Conducted clearance evaluations and prepared and prosecuted patent applications for a Fortune 100 automotive company, including significant work on adjustable seating assemblies and semiautonomous vehicle navigation control systems
  • Prepared and prosecuted patent applications on water filtration and ice making devices for home appliance products of a Fortune 500 company
  • Prior to becoming an attorney, worked as an engineering intern at John Deere in the Harvester Works factory on manufacturing audit software along with other mechanical engineering and supply management projects
